About this task
During the installation planning, you can enable disaster recovery for your rack in either of
these methods:
- You have already set up your first rack as Site 1. During the installation of Site 2, connect it to Site 1 in a Metro-DR relationship.
- You already got a standalone rack set up but not designated it as Site 1. During the installation of Site 2, utilize the connection snippet of Site 1 to establish a Metro-DR relationship between the two racks.
